How much do remote amazon scrum master j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 29,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ote amazon scrum master in Austin, TX is $57.51,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$49.09 and $65.53 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Remote Amazon Scrum Master do?

A Remote Amazon Scrum Master is responsible for facilitating agile processes and ensuring that Scrum practices are followed within Amazon's distributed teams. They help coordinate sprints, remove obstacles, and foster communication between team members working from various locations. Their main goal is to help the team deliver high-quality products efficiently while adapting to changes and continuously improving their workflow. As a remote role, they also leverage digital tools to maintain collaboration and productivity across different time zones.

How does a Remote Amazon Scrum Master typically facilitate team collaboration and communication across different time zones?

As a Remote Amazon Scrum Master, you’ll be responsible for ensuring seamless communication and collaboration among team members who may be spread across various locations and time zones. This often involves scheduling regular stand-ups, sprint planning, and retrospectives at mutually agreeable times, leveraging collaboration tools like Amazon Chime, Slack, or Jira. You'll also need to proactively address challenges related to asynchronous work, such as delayed feedback or miscommunication, by establishing clear documentation practices and promoting transparency. Strong organizational and interpersonal skills are key to fostering an inclusive and efficient team environment remotely.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Amazon Scrum Master,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Amazon Scrum Master, you need a deep understanding of Agile methodologies, Scrum framework, and experience leading cross-functional teams, often supported by a Scrum Master certification (CSM or PSM). Familiarity with project management tools like Jira or Trello and collaboration platforms such as Slack or Zoom is typically expected. Strong communication, facilitation, and conflict resolution skills are crucial for remote team coordination and stakeholder engagement. These skills and qualities ensure effective project delivery, team productivity, and alignment with Amazon's high-performance standards in a distributed environment.

What is the difference between Remote Amazon Scrum Master vs Remote Agile Coach?

AspectRemote Amazon Scrum MasterRemote Agile Coach
CertificationsScrum Master Certification (CSM, PSM)Scrum Master Certification, Agile certifications (SAFe, ICP-ACC)
Work EnvironmentTeam-focused, project-specificOrganization-wide, strategic
Employer & Industry UsageAmazon, e-commerce, tech companiesVarious industries, consulting firms, large enterprises
Search & Comparison IntentFocus on Scrum Master roles at AmazonFocus on Agile coaching at organizational level

The Remote Amazon Scrum Master primarily facilitates Scrum teams within Amazon, focusing on project delivery and team processes. In contrast, a Remote Agile Coach works across multiple teams or organizations to implement Agile practices at a strategic level. Both roles require Scrum certifications, but Agile Coaches often hold additional certifications and have broader responsibilities. The Scrum Master role is more team-centric, while the Agile Coach influences organizational agility.
